ホームページ > データベース > Oracle > オラクルでは「」は何を意味しますか?

オラクルでは「」は何を意味しますか?

下次还敢
リリース: 2024-05-07 16:21:14
オリジナル
695 人が閲覧しました

Oracle では、文字列を接続するためにパイプ文字 (‖) が使用されます。 2 つの文字列を 1 つの文字列に連結し、どちらかが NULL の場合、結果は NULL になります。複数の文字列をより高い優先度で連結できます。数値または日付値を連結することはできません。

オラクルでは「」は何を意味しますか?

Oracleのパイプライン文字(‖)

Oracleのパイプライン文字(‖)は、2つの文字列を連結するために使用される演算子です。連結の結果は、2 つの文字列が連結された 1 つの文字列になります。

構文:

<code>string1 ‖ string2</code>
ログイン後にコピー

操作:

パイプ文字は 2 つの文字列を接続します。いずれかの文字列が NULL の場合、結果は NULL になります。連結された文字列には、スペースやその他の文字区切り文字は含まれません。

例:

<code>SELECT 'Hello' ‖ 'World' FROM dual;</code>
ログイン後にコピー

結果:

<code>Hello</code>
ログイン後にコピー

文字列の追加:

パイプ文字は、ある文字列を別の文字列の末尾に追加するために使用できます。たとえば、次のクエリは、「Hello」文字列の末尾に「!」を追加します:

<code>SELECT 'Hello' ‖ '!' FROM dual;</code>
ログイン後にコピー

結果:

<code>Hello!</code>
ログイン後にコピー

複数の文字列を連結します:

パイプ文字は複数の文字列を連結できます。たとえば、次のクエリは 3 つの文字列を連結します。

<code>SELECT 'Hello' ‖ ' ' ‖ 'World' ‖ '!' FROM dual;</code>
ログイン後にコピー

結果:

<code>Hello World!</code>
ログイン後にコピー

注:

  • パイプ演算子は、他のほとんどの演算子よりも高い優先順位で動作します。
  • 連結された文字列に特殊文字 (一重引用符や二重引用符など) が含まれている場合は、エスケープ文字 () を使用してこれらの文字をエスケープする必要があります。
  • パイプ文字を使用して数値または日付値を連結することはできません。

以上がオラクルでは「」は何を意味しますか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

関連ラベル:
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ート